I've always liked the idea of how the Light Side and Dark Side were represented in FFG's RPG, and wished there was a clever way to add it to their miniatures games. How it worked is that there were a number of double sided tokens (white on one side for LS, black on the other side for DS) and when you wanted to use the Force to manipulate something, you flipped it over which then gave the other side use of it.

Maybe in Armada each player would have a double sided token - each player sets theirs to their side's color (red/blue maybe?) to start the game. You can use either token as long as it is showing your color. Maybe you could spend it to reroll 1 die up to 2 times (either yours or your opponents). Spending it flips it over, but it is discarded after your opponent uses your token - that way it's easy to track and each player only get 2 uses out of this ability per game.

I like the idea of "using the Force" to change your odds.

My "You know what would be cool..." list

  1. Executor epic-scale expansion. Yeah, I want it.
  2. Braha'tok gunship. A small-size flotilla with reasonable dice pools and no fleet support slot. A combat flotilla.
  3. Ithorian herdship. A medium-size slow ship with fleet support upgrades, and new fleet support upgrade cards too.
  4. Official support for enhanced terrain pieces. 3D obstacles, please. Let's not have had Space Rocks die in vain.
  5. New titles, even new ship variants. Package them with some repaints or something.
  6. An Outer Rim campaign expansion. One player starts with a modest Scum fleet that includes some squadrons and small ships, and he captures enemy ships along the way. Other players are Rebel or Imperial commanders trying to fight back against the burgeoning pirate empire. Scum faction compatible cards for Firesprays, JM5Ks, Aggressors, YV-666s, Y-Wings, Z-95s, VCXs, and Shadowcasters. Maybe some new squadrons of classic Scum ships, like Scyks, Starvipers, and Protectorate Fighters. These squadrons wouldn't be tournament-legal under most circumstances, but a limited number of them would be if you included some kind of Scum-friendly upgrade card. This introduces classic Scum ships in a safe way that doesn't commit them to supporting a third faction. But, if viable capital ship options come along the road (like the Mandalorians on Star Wars Rebels, for instance), they have room to build.
  7. Immobilizer-class Star Destroyer. A small-base (600m compared to the Interdictor's 1600m) ship with experimental retrofit slots and new upgrades.
  8. Katana fleet expansion. A dreadnaught model, with an Imperial dreadnaught ship card and another Rebel ship card. Small base, but perhaps as much as six hull and three command. A pocket battleship. And Thrawn as a commander.
  9. Quasar carriers as an Imperial ship, but with a unique title that lets Rebels field one.
